Students of cognitive technologies prepared an exhibition

On the 20th of May, an exhibition prepared with the participation of students of cognitive technologies and social media – Laura Łukaszczyk and Oliwia Glombek  - was presented at the Faculty of Organization and Management of the Silesian University of Technology.

Students of the Faculty of Organization and Management of the Silesian University of Technology took part in a scientific and research project, as part of which the exhibition was created. The effect of the three-month work was presented yesterday with the participation of students and employees of the Zabrze faculty.

The event was opened by the Dean of the Faculty of Organization and Management Dr Hab. Aleksandra Kuzior, Prof. SUT, who congratulated the students on their results.

“I am proud that students of cognitive technologies and social media have completed such an interesting exhibition and gained valuable experience,” she said.

The project “Silesian opinion leaders, i.e. the unofficial representation of Silesians” was an interesting challenge for students. It included several stages. In the first phase of the implementation, a survey of the opinion of the inhabitants of the Silesian Voivodeship was commissioned on a sample of 500 people. The participants answered questions about opinion leaders. The respondents indicated who – by name and surname – they consider to be the leader of opinion in the field of Silesian issues; what qualities should these leaders have; what professions they represent and what topics they should be interested in in particular.

After receiving the results of the research, the team implementing the project on the basis of the collected data selected an “eleven,” i.e. an unofficial representation, who were then invited to cooperate later in the project.

Leaders were invited to meetings with students, during which the role of opinion leaders in society was discussed. The project manager is Katarzyna Siwczyk, who is associated with the Centre for Promotion and Media Communication of the Silesian University of Technology and the Institute of Journalism and Media Communication of the University of Silesia. The participants of the project were students of journalism and social communication, cognitive technologies and social media, and graphic design from three Silesian universities – Silesian University of Technology, University of Economics and University of Silesia. This group included two students of the Silesian University of Technology, who themselves applied for participation - Laura Łukaszczyk and Oliwia Glombek.

Laura Łukaszczyk was responsible for preparing graphics based on photographs taken during meetings or obtained from archives. The author does not hide that it was an interesting challenge.

- “I tried to refer to the Silesian landscape, hence the characters were presented against the background of the mine shaft, and the characteristic elements were presented in yellow and blue Silesian colours. In addition, I had to deal with searching the archives to obtain photos of people who have already passed away” - Laura said.

Artificial intelligence has also been helpful in preparing the exhibition.

In turn, Olivia Glombek in this project was responsible for preparing promotional materials.

- “I made video recordings, rolls, posts on social media and took care of communication about the event. It was a valuable experience,” - she added.

Work on the project lasted from October to December last year. The exhibition was presented for the first time at the Silesian Science Festival in Katowice. Currently, until May 29, it can be seen in the lobby of the Faculty of Organization and Management. In turn, from the 3rd of June it will be on display at the Faculty of Social Sciences of the University of Silesia.

The project was co-financed by the Upper Silesian Zagłębie Metropolis grant, within the framework of the “Science of the Young” Grant Program – European City of Science 2024.
